Dominating Local SEO for Your WooCommerce Store in the UK

Local SEO is vital for any WooCommerce store operating within the UK. By optimizing your online presence for local searches, you can attract potential customers in your read more geographic area and boost your sales.

Begin with creating a Google My Business (GMB) listing and ensuring all your data are accurate and up-to-date. This includes your business name, address, phone number, website URL, and opening hours. Encourage clients to leave reviews on your GMB listing as positive reviews can significantly improve your local search ranking.

, Additionally optimize your WooCommerce store's content for local keywords. Research relevant keywords that potential customers in your area might use when searching for products or services like yours. Integrate these keywords into your product descriptions, page titles, and meta descriptions.

Building local citations on platforms is another effective way to improve your local SEO. List your business on relevant UK-based directories such as Yelp, TripAdvisor, and industry-specific platforms. Remember to consistently update your citations with accurate information.
